O R D E R

% 23.01.2019 1.

I have been informed by counsel for the parties that Arbitral Tribunal has been constituted.

2.

In these circumstances, the captioned petition is disposed of with the following directions:- (i) The Arbitral Tribunal will adjudicate upon the instant petition by treating the same as the one filed under Section 17 of the Arbitration and Conciliation Act, 1996 ( in short " The Act"). (ii) Pending adjudication, the interim order passed by this Court dated 27.09.2018 will continue to operate.

O.M.P.(I) (COMM.) 376/2018

(iii) The Arbitral Tribunal, will however, have the liberty to either confirm, vacate or even modify the order dated 27.09.2018, albeit, after giving due opportunity to both sides.

3.

No costs.
